Product Description
One of the finest spring flowering bulbs. Produces a wealth of white star-shaped flowers. Closely related to Scilla, Chionodoxa are an excellent choice for rockeries or for borders, and can be left to naturalise over time. They will establish quickly and will flower in February to April, producing a breath-taking carpet of white. 4cm+ bulbs supplied.

Growing at a glance…
Plant Chionodoxa bulbs 5cm deep and 5cm apart. As the bulbs are so small, plant en-masse for a floriferous effect! Position in well-drained soil and ensure they will receive plenty of sunlight once in bloom. Can be grown in any bed, border, or container for an early season display.
